Airline 9020A The single 'minus sign' speaker cutout brace is readily visible in this photo. The images on this page come from three separate amplifiers. I am not sure if the logo differences are due to varying model years or if they simply have been lost over the years. I have ran across examples of amplifiers with only the script "Airline", only the 'V' and with both. My assumption is that the amplifiers were supplied with both and one or the other gets lost to the vagaries of time. If anyone can provide more insight into this please let me know.





Interior of Airline amplifier chassis. The Airline Chassis lacks the internal wooden braces of the Supro Chassis. Note that it otherwise is identical, even the component selection and manufacturers.





Airline 62-9034

As best I can determine, the Airline 62-9034 is the same as the 62-9020a with the exception of the color scheme. The only example I can find a picture of has been re-housed in a newly manufactured cabinet. The cabinet and baffle structure are different on this amp giving it more of the TV front appearance that is sometimes found on Airline offerings. The owner of the picture stated the new cabinet was a copy of the old with the exception of the material used. The old cab was plywood, he used solid pine to make the copy. The handle pictured is not original, a VOX handle was used. I do not know if the baffle board has the vertical brace beside the speaker, but it does appear to have the '+' pattern in the speaker cutout.
